If you are using Twitter in your professional life, you probably don't want to communicate by furiously thumb-typing on your cell phone and receiving frequent text messages. 

If you are a Outlook user, you can integrate tweets into Outlook with this free application.

It's tough to determine if social media outlets, such as Twitter and Facebook will increase revenue for a medical practice. But, they do increase visibility. Many patients use Twitter and Facebook to connect professionally and personally. They use these tools to refer others to their favorite OB/GYN, or their favorite dentist, for example. A medical practice should be ready for these informal referrals by having an optimized website, and a way to connect with them on Twitter or Facebook.
